Transaction 75e5191f9f9a1fa2a35207fcbc6e70f239e655c42c44384892a9e748e73a7134
1 Input
2 Outputs
- 75e5191f9f9a1fa2a35207fcbc6e70f239e655c42c44384892a9e748e73a7134:0
- 75e5191f9f9a1fa2a35207fcbc6e70f239e655c42c44384892a9e748e73a7134:1
value 8004440
address 15Fo8qdfi8E7gtyfZfxBiWrw3ZaweDaN7E
value 118930
address 138sahNyLmcDX2idq1VurCek9FGZfqoQPV